Understanding the Foundations: Lines and Angles

In precision cutting, every line and angle is intentional. Lines are categorized into horizontal, vertical, and diagonal, each serving a unique purpose:

  • Horizontal lines build weight and create solidity, ideal for blunt cuts and bobs.
  • Vertical lines remove weight and provide length and fluidity, commonly used in layered cuts.
  • Diagonal lines combine these effects, offering controlled movement and seamless blending, perfect for shaping dynamic styles.

Angles determine how hair layers or graduates. Lower angles create weight and structure; higher angles remove weight and add volume. Mastering how angles interact allows stylists to precisely control the density and movement within a haircut.

Curved Forms: Beyond Straight Lines

While straight lines provide clarity and structure, curved lines introduce softness and flow. Convex curves follow the head’s natural shape, adding gentle volume and fluidity. Concave curves do the opposite, removing internal weight, creating lift, and accentuating movement. Stylists proficient in integrating curved geometry can craft customized cuts that look effortlessly natural and adapt beautifully to clients’ lifestyles.

Precision in Practice: Graduated Shapes and Layering

Graduation and layering exemplify geometric cutting techniques:

  • Graduation involves gradually building weight using specific angles (commonly 45 degrees). This technique is perfect for structured cuts like graduated bobs, creating clean silhouettes that taper beautifully.
  • Layering typically involves higher elevations (often 90 degrees and above), evenly removing weight for dynamic movement and texture. Precise layering geometry allows stylists to shape hair that moves fluidly, ensuring consistency throughout the style.

Tailoring Geometry to Face Shape and Bone Structure

Precision geometry isn’t just technical—it’s highly personalized. Each client’s unique head shape, facial structure, and natural growth patterns influence the ideal geometry for their haircut. For example:

  • Round faces benefit from vertical lines and higher angles that elongate the shape.
  • Angular faces often require softer curves and lower angles to create balance and softness.
  • Oval faces can adapt to a range of geometries, providing stylists with creative flexibility.

The Role of Sectioning in Geometric Cutting

Sectioning is the blueprint for precision. Clearly defined, meticulously placed sections allow for accurate angle and line execution, ensuring consistency and symmetry. Expert stylists use intricate sectioning patterns—such as pivoting radial sections for rounded shapes or diagonal-back sections for sleek graduation—to achieve exacting precision in their geometric cuts.
